As one component of the energy transition formula, biomethane has a lot to recommend it. Instead of the linear “take, make, waste” model that has done so much damage to the climate, biomethane relies on a “take waste and make” process. Chemically identical to natural gas, biomethane is manufactured by putting food and agricultural wastes and other feedstocks through an anaerobic digestion process.The biomethane can be injected directly into the gas grid or used as a fuel for transport or heat. And, completing the circle, the byproducts of the production process are rich in nutrients and can be used as fertiliser on the very farms that provided the waste in first place.It’s little wonder then that the Government has set a production target of 5.7TWh of biomethane annually by 2030, enough to power half a million homes. But just how realistic is that target?“The 5.7 TWh target was ambitious when it was first established and, given the slow pace of development to date, it is now unlikely to be fully achieved by 2030,” says Russell Smyth, head of sustainable futures and corporate finance at KPMG. “However, that does not mean the target has failed. Biomethane projects typically take several years to move from concept to operation, and much of the sector has been waiting for policy certainty.”Russell Smyth, sustainable futures lead, KPMG He says the forthcoming Renewable Heat Obligation (RHO), which will require fuel suppliers to source a proportion of their energy from renewable fuels such as biomethane, is expected to provide a long-term route to market for producers. “With the RHO progressing and more projects expected to connect over the coming years, production should increase significantly,” he adds.Progress has been relatively slow so far, however. “As of last year, only two biomethane plants were injecting gas into the national network, which is well below the level required to achieve the 2030 target,” Russell points out. “However, momentum is beginning to build. More projects are expected to connect this year, while developers, farmers, suppliers and investors are becoming increasingly active in the sector.”The project pipeline is also growing, with more than 20 biomethane plants granted planning permission by local authorities since 2020, he notes. “In addition, a number of planning applications are currently awaiting determination, while many developers are progressing project platforms with the intention of submitting further applications in the coming years. The introduction of clearer policy support and a route to market through the RHO should help unlock further investment and accelerate deployment over the remainder of the decade.”Aisling O’Donoghue, partner, energy, infrastructure and natural resources with A&L Goodbody, says a number of policy and regulatory efforts are under way to address barriers to investment in biomethane production.Aisling O'Donoghue, partner, energy, infrastructure and natural resources group, A&L Goodbody “Critically, in order to scale biomethane production in Ireland, we need viable and diversified routes to market for project developers,” she says. “That means long-term offtake contracts with transport fuel suppliers, heat suppliers and industrial customers that help underpin capital investment.”She also notes the importance of the RHO, saying it is an imperative for developers, but points to a delay in finalising the regulation. She explains that earlier this year the EU Commission published a “reasoned opinion” in relation to the Irish Government’s proposed RHO scheme and its “multiplier” for entities purchasing domestically produced biomethane, and its compatibility with EU law.“Following this opinion, a revised proposal on the scheme which adequately addresses the EU Commission’s concern in respect of free trade between member states was required. Finalisation of this scheme will be one of the most crucial investment signals for the biomethane market,” O’Donoghue says.Outside of the RHO, several other challenges remain, according to Smyth. “Feedstock availability will be critical to supporting large-scale biomethane production,” he explains. “Most Irish biomethane plants are expected to be based on agricultural feedstocks, including slurry and other residues. While this presents a significant opportunity to create new revenue streams for farmers and support rural economies, sufficient feedstock must be secured and mobilised to support a large number of projects.”Grid connection timelines have also been a worry for developers seeking to inject gas into the network, he adds. “Policy uncertainty has been another major barrier, delaying investment decisions for several years. While the RHO helps address that challenge, the absence of incentives for indigenous biomethane means local producers will have to compete against imports from more established markets. Faster project delivery, efficient grid connections and continued market confidence will be essential to growing a competitive indigenous biomethane industry.”
